Tutorial de mutare WordPress: cum să schimbați numele de domeniu pentru spațiul de transfer al site-ului?

WordPressTutorial de mutare: cum se schimbă numele de domeniu pentru spațiul de transfer al site-ului web?

din cauzaChen WeiliangCuvinte sensibile (numele liderilor de stat chinezi) au apărut pe unul dintre site-urile web responsabile, dar, în mod neașteptat, au fost blocate și nu pot fi accesate în China continentală.

Observația a constatat că există o mulțime de site-uri web străine legitime, din cauza apariției cuvintelor sensibile, acestea sunt blocate de firewall-ul rețelei chinezești, deci indiferent de ceea ce facemnoi mediafurnizor de energie electricăCând operați un site web, trebuie să acordați o atenție deosebită dacă site-ul are cuvinte sensibile și să utilizați tehnologia pentru a filtra cuvintele sensibile pentru a reduce riscul de a fi blocat.

Cum se detectează dacă numele de domeniu al unui site web este blocat?Puteți consulta acest articol:"Ce ar trebui să fac dacă IP-ul numelui de domeniu al site-ului web este blocat?Interogare de detectare a firewall-ului Chinei"

Acest articol rezumă tutorialele despre mutarea și schimbarea numelor de domeniu WordPress. În general, pașii pentru mutarea site-ului web sunt următorii:

  • XNUMX. Efectuați backup pentru fișierele site-ului blogului și bazele de date;
  • XNUMX. Transferați fișierele site-ului web în noul spațiu și importați baza de date în noul spațiu;
  • XNUMX. Modificați configurația site-ului și baza de date;
  • XNUMX. Schimbați un nou nume de domeniu;
  • XNUMX. Verificați rezultatele transferului.

Există 3 situații în care site-ul WordPress se mută

  • 1. Schimbați spațiul, nu numele domeniului
  • 2. Schimbați numele domeniului fără a schimba spațiul
  • 3. Schimbați numele domeniului, schimbați și spațiul

XNUMX. Faceți backup pentru fișierele site-ului blogului și bazele de date

1) Descărcați și faceți backup pentru fișierul blogului în spațiul original:

  • Dacă spațiul original acceptă decompresia online, se recomandă să împachetați și să descărcați, astfel încât dimensiunea de descărcare să fie mai mică și să se economisească mult timp.
  • (Folosesc practic FTP pentru a sincroniza și a face backup în local dacă am actualizări ale articolelor. Cel mai bine este ca toată lumea să aibă acest obicei, altfel accidentul brusc te va face să regreti!)

2) Faceți o copie de rezervă a bazei de date:

  • capabil să treacăphpMyAdmin, Empire Backup King sau un plug-in de backup al bazei de date precum WP-DBManager, puteți alege o metodă cu care sunteți familiarizat.

 

Mai multe tutoriale despre mutarea site-ului WordPress▼

XNUMX. Încărcați fișierul blog și importați baza de date

1) Folosiți FTP pentru a încărca fișiere de blog în noul spațiu.La fel ca și descărcarea, dacă noul spațiu acceptă decompresia online, se recomandă împachetarea și încărcarea, ceea ce economisește mult timp și trafic.

  • De obicei, directorul WordPress se află sub public_html/, așa că doar încărcați fișierele din directorul public_html/ în public_html/ al noii gazde.

2) Importați baza de date: PHPMyAdmin, Empire Backup King o pot face.

  • Trebuie să creați o bază de date în noua gazdă și apoi să importați baza de date pe care ați exportat-o ​​mai devreme.

3) Utilizați prin SSH MySQL Comanda pentru importul bazei de date ▼

XNUMX. Modificați configurația site-ului web și baza de date (cheie)

1) Modificați fișierul wp-config, cel mai bine este să nu utilizați Notepad pentru a-l modifica, folosiți un editor precum notepad++ sau UltraEdit și punețiBaza de date MySQLInformațiile sunt modificate în informațiile bazei de date ale noului spațiu, după cum urmează:

/** WordPress 数据库的名称 */

define('DB_NAME', '你的新空间数据库名称');

/** MySQL 数据库用户名 */

define('DB_USER', '你的数据库用户名');

/** MySQL 数据库密码 */

define('DB_PASSWORD', '你的数据库登录密码');

/** MySQL 主机 */

define('DB_HOST', '你的数据库地址');

Completați numele bazei de date, numele de utilizator și parola noului spațiu gazdă.Rețineți că gazda MySQL este „localhost” în mod implicit. Dacă sunteți o gazdă Windows, nu o modificați. Dacă esteLinuxGazdă, poate fi necesar să completați adresa bazei de date.

2) Introduceți phpMyAdmin în noul spațiu pentru a modifica baza de date: modificați valorile câmpurilor „siteurl” și „home” din tabelul bazei de date wp_options și schimbați-le în noua adresă de nume de domeniu;

3) Conectați-vă la serverul de nume de domeniu (de exemplu: DNSPOD) și rezolvați numele domeniului la adresa IP a noului spațiu.

4) Conectați-vă la panoul de control al găzduirii și adăugați un nume de domeniu.

  • Cum săPanoul de control CWPAdăugați un nume de domeniu?Vă rugăm să consultați următorul tutorial ▼

Înlocuiți calea serverului și numele domeniului

Instalați pluginul WP Migrate DB ▼

  • Potrivit pentru mutarea site-ului web (poate înlocui calea serverului)
  • Înlocuiți cuvintele cheie cu baza de date și exportați ca bază de date MySQL
  • Utilizați funcția „Găsiți și înlocuiți” pentru a înlocui rapid calea serverului și numele domeniului

phpMyAdmin modifică calea serverului și numele domeniului

  • daca folosestiWP Migrați DBPlugin care exportă un fișier de bază de date MySQL cu calea serverului și numele de domeniu înlocuite.
  • Doar în phpMyAdmin, faceți clic pe numele bazei de date → faceți clic pe „Importați” pentru a o importa direct (puteți sări cu ușurință pașii de înlocuire de mai jos).

Primul pas:În phpMyAdmin, faceți clic pe numele bazei de date pe care doriți să o modificați.

Al doilea pas:Apoi, faceți clic pe Căutare.

Al treilea pas:Căutați căi vechi

  • Înlocuiți calea veche a spațiului web (adresa folderului) cu calea nouă
  • Vechea cale a dosarului: /home/abc/public_html/site/etOZN.org /
  • Noua cale de folder: /data/abc/etOZN.org /

al patrulea pas:Căutați domenii vechi

Nume de domeniu vechi: http://www.ufo.org.in 

Nume de domeniu nou:http://www.etufo.org

Cuvântul cheie de căutare phpMyAdmin nr. 6

Găsiți rezultatele căutării după cum se arată mai jos:

Rezultatul căutării phpMyAdmin nr. 7

  • Există link-uri sau imagini în articolul original și sunt folosite adresele numelor de domenii anterioare, așa că acele adrese trebuie modificate.

al cincilea pas: Faceți clic stânga pe „Răsfoiți”;

În acest fel, atunci când noua fereastră este deschisă, partea inferioară va sări automat în poziția câmpului (filtrare automată, arătând în ce câmp se află cuvântul cheie).

Notă: Calea spațiului site-ului web (adresa folderului) ar trebui, de asemenea, înlocuită. Vă rugăm să căutați și să înlocuiți singur, în funcție de situația dvs.

De exemplu, în phpMyAdmin, executați următoarea instrucțiune:

UPDATE wp_options SET option_value = REPLACE(option_value,'旧地址','新地址');

UPDATE wp_posts SET post_content = replace (post_content,'旧地址','新地址');

UPDATE wp_posts SET post_excerpt = replace (post_excerpt,'旧地址','新地址');

UPDATE wp_posts SET guid = replace (guid, '旧地址','新地址');

Descrierea instrucțiunii SQL:UPDATE nume tabel de date SET field = înlocuiți (câmp, „adresă veche”, „adresă nouă”);

În al patrulea rând, schimbați noul nume de domeniu

Dacă trebuie să schimbați un nou nume de domeniu, vă rugăm să-l urmați. Dacă nu schimbați numele de domeniu, vă rugăm să omiteți acest pas.

  • Numele de domeniu inițial este 301 redirecționat către noul nume de domeniu → modificați conținutul bazei de date.

Faceți o redirecționare 301:

  • Scopul redirecționării 301 este de a face conținutul indexat de motorul de căutare original să se îndrepte către noul nume de domeniu.Există multe modalități de a-l realiza.

Dacă utilizați o gazdă Linux+Apache, puteți alege să modificați fișierul .htaccess și să introduceți următorul cod în acest fișier:

RewriteEngine on
RewriteCond %{HTTP_HOST} www.ufo.org.in
RewriteRule ^(.*) https://www.etufo.org/$1 [L,R=301]

Ca mai sus, vechiul nume de domeniu este http://www.ufo.org.in, noul nume de domeniu este http://www.etufo.org

Sau, dacă utilizatorul dvs. este o gazdă Windows (nu este recomandat, deoarece gazda Windows este pe deplin compatibilă cu WordPress), puteți alege să modificați wp-blog-header.php în directorul rădăcină al blogului WordPress, în

if (strtolower($_SERVER['SERVER_NAME'])!=’原域名’)
{
$URIRedirect=$_SERVER['REQUEST_URI'];
if(strtolower($URIRedirect)==’/index.php’) {
$URIRedirect=’/’;
}
header(‘HTTP/1.1 301 Moved Permanently’);
header(‘Location:http://新域名’.$URIRedirect);
exit();
}

XNUMX. Verificați rezultatele transferului

Luați un moment și verificați recepția site-ului pentru erori?

  1. Verificați unul câte unul pluginurile de fundal ale site-ului web și setările temei, ceea ce poate reduce diferitele pierderi cauzate de erorile de pe site-ul dvs.
  2. De exemplu, unele date ale plug-in-ului de ancorare automată keywordlink vor fi șterse automat și numai plug-in-ul de ancorare automată keywordlink pentru care sa făcut backup anterior va fi importat.

După ce site-ul WordPress s-a mutat și a schimbat numele de domeniu, chiar a fost o problemă, nu știu cum să o rezolv, ce ar trebui să fac?

  • referinţăChen WeiliangTutorialul de mutare WP distribuit de blog este încă de nerezolvat.Este recomandat să-ți pui problema pe motorul de căutare, astfel încât problemele pe care le întâlnești precum mutarea site-ului WordPress și schimbarea numelui de domeniu să poată fi de obicei rezolvate cu ușurință.

Urmați instrucțiunile de mai sus și vă veți putea muta cu succes în cel mai scurt timp!

Felicitări, site-ul dvs. WordPress a fost transferat cu succes!

Lectură suplimentară:

Hope Chen Weiliang Blog ( https://www.chenweiliang.com/ ) a distribuit „Tutorial de mutare WordPress: cum se schimbă numele de domeniu pentru spațiul de transfer al site-ului? , sa te ajut.

Bine ați venit să distribuiți linkul acestui articol:https://www.chenweiliang.com/cwl-528.html

Bun venit pe canalul Telegram al blogului lui Chen Weiliang pentru a primi cele mai recente actualizări!

🔔 Fii primul care primește valorosul „Ghid de utilizare a instrumentului AI pentru marketing de conținut ChatGPT” în directorul de top al canalului! 🌟
📚 Acest ghid conține o valoare uriașă, 🌟Aceasta este o oportunitate rară, nu o ratați! ⏰⌛💨
Distribuie si da like daca iti place!
Partajarea și like-urile tale sunt motivația noastră continuă!

 

发表 评论

Adresa ta de email nu va fi publicată. Sunt utilizate câmpurile obligatorii * Eticheta

derulați în sus